The Bulls Knob
The Bulls Knob is a peak in Somerset, Queensland and has an elevation of 550 metres. The Bulls Knob is situated nearby to the hamlet Laceys Creek, as well as near the locality Dundas.- Type: Peak with an elevation of 550 metres
